Maintenance Tips for Prolonged Trailer Life
Proper maintenance of your dual axle trailer ensures its longevity and optimal performance. Begin with routine inspections, focusing on the axles, tyres, and braking systems for any signs of wear or damage. Tire care is vital; keep them properly inflated and rotate them regularly to ensure even wear.
Lubrication of moving parts, such as the coupler and wheel bearings, is essential to prevent rust and facilitate smooth operation. Make it a habit to clean your trailer thoroughly, especially after hauling materials that could cause corrosion or damage. Regularly checking and tightening all bolts and fasteners can prevent structural issues.

Choosing the Right trailers for sale Brisbane for Your Needs
Selecting the appropriate trailers for sale Brisbane involves assessing your specific transport requirements and understanding the unique features of each trailer type. Begin by identifying the type of loads you plan to haul regularly, whether it’s construction materials, machinery, or personal items. Brisbane’s diverse road conditions should also factor into your decision; trailers designed for heavy-duty use are often better suited for urban and rural environments.
Next, consider the towing capacity of your vehicle to ensure compatibility with the trailer you choose. Investigate the build quality and materials used in the trailer’s construction, prioritizing those that offer durability and resistance to wear and tear. Look for trailers with essential features such as reinforced frames, high-quality axles, and reliable braking systems.
Customization options can significantly enhance the trailer’s functionality. Features like adjustable tie-down points, removable sides, and additional storage solutions can provide convenience. Consulting with local Brisbane dealers can offer valuable insights and help you find a trailer that perfectly matches your transport needs. Considering these factors, you can ensure you make an informed and practical investment.
